Välja och konfigurera berörda objekt (SybaseToSQL)

På den här sidan kan du välja tabeller och externa nycklar vars ändringar ska jämföras när SSMA verifierar resultatet av körningen för de objekt som valts i föregående steg. Du kan också anpassa verifieringsparametrarna.

Val av berörda objekt

I Sybase-objektträdet till vänster i fönstret kontrollerar du tabellerna och externa nycklar, vars ändringar bör jämföras för att säkerställa identiskhet.

Om SSMA-testaren inte kan verifiera något av dessa objekt visas länken märkt Vissa markerade objekt innehåller fel under objektträdet. Klicka på den här länken om du vill visa orsakerna till att dessa objekt inte kan jämföras och för att rensa markeringen av fel objekt.

Tabell

Fliken Tabell innehåller rutnätsvyn för den valda tabellen. Rutnätet innehåller följande information om den valda tabellen:

  • Kolumnnamn

  • Datatyp

  • Noggrannhet

  • Scale

  • Regel

  • Förinställning

  • Identitet

  • Nullbar

SQL

SQL-fliken innehåller SQL-filen "Skapa tabell" för den valda tabellen.

Uppgifter

Fliken Data visar data som finns i den valda tabellen.

Egenskaper

Fliken Egenskaper visar Egenskaper för den valda tabellen. Följande fält finns under fliken Egenskaper:

  • Skapad eller senast ändrad

  • Objektnamn

Inställningar för tabelljämförelse

Upprätta jämförelsereglerna för tabellen på sidan Tabelljämförelser . Du kan göra följande inställningar.

Jämförelseläge

Definierar det tabellinnehåll som jämförelsen ska utföras på.

  • Om du väljer Endast ändringar utförs en fullständig jämförelse av tabellrader.

  • Om du väljer Fullständig utförs jämförelsen för endast de rader som har ändrats.

Inställningar för kolumnjämförelse

Upprätta jämförelsereglerna för tabellkolumner på sidan Kolumnjämförelser . Du kan göra följande inställningar.

Använda under testjämförelser

Kontrollera om den här kolumnen kommer att delta i verifiering av testresultat.

  • Om du väljer Sant jämför SSMA innehållet i den här kolumnen när du har kört testet på Sybase med innehållet i kolumnen i SQL Server.

  • Om du väljer False undantas kolumnen från resultatverifieringen.

Använda anpassad skala

För kolumner av numerisk datatyp kan du ange en anpassad skala för jämförelsen.

  • Om du väljer Sant avrundas numeriska värden enligt värdet Jämföra skalning innan de jämförs.

  • Om du väljer False är den numeriska jämförelsen exakt.

Jämförelse av skala

  • Endast tillgängligt om alternativet Använd anpassad skalning är inställt på Sant. Det här är precisionen för numerisk jämförelse.

Jämförelse av datum och tid

Definierar hur datum/tid-värden jämförs.

  • Om du väljer Jämför helt datum utförs en fullständig jämförelse av värden från båda plattformarna.

  • Om du väljer Jämför endast datum ignoreras tidsdelen.

  • Om du väljer Jämför endast tid ignoreras datumdelen.

  • Om du väljer Ignorera millisekunder jämförs resultatet upp till sekunder.

  • Om du väljer Ignorera datum och millisekunder jämförs resultatet endast med tidsdel och ignorera bråkdelar av en sekund.

Ignorera strängars skiftlägeskänslighet

Styr jämförelsens skiftlägeskänslighet.

  • Om du väljer Sant blir jämförelsen skiftlägesokänslig.

  • Om du väljer Falskt står jämförelsen för brevfall.

Jämförelse av SQL

Du kan visa SELECT-uttryck som genereras av SSMA-testare på sidan Jämför SQL . Testaren kommer att jämföra resultatmängderna för dessa uttalanden rad för rad. Varje nästa rad i en Sybase-resultatuppsättning ska vara lika med nästa rad i resultatuppsättningen som skapas i SQL Server.

Du kan redigera dessa SELECT-instruktioner för att tillhandahålla anpassad verifiering. Om du vill spara ändringarna i Sybase och SQL Server-instruktioner använder du knapparna Tillämpa under käll- och mål-SQL på motsvarande sätt.

Nästa steg

Anpassa anropsordning (SybaseToSQL)

Se även

Köra testfall (SybaseToSQL)
Testa migrerade databasobjekt (SybaseToSQL)